What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Ariel is a Shar-Pei mix, and these dogs usually do well in homes that offer stability and calm. They appreciate a consistent routine and a peaceful household.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
Shar-Pei mixes like Ariel benefit from moderate outdoor spaceāa fenced yard is ideal but regular walks and playtime can also keep her happy.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Arielās Shar-Pei roots usually indicate a calm dog that can adapt to homes with children if introductions are managed thoughtfully and children respect her space.
